Venue | Queen's Park Oval, Port of Spain on 17th March 2007 (50-over match) |
Balls per over | 6 |
Toss | India won the toss and decided to bat |
Result | Bangladesh won by 5 wickets |
Points | Bangladesh 2; India 0 |
Umpires | Aleem Dar (Pakistan), SJ Davis (Australia) |
TV umpire | IL Howell (South Africa) |
Referee | AG Hurst (Australia) |
Reserve Umpire | DJ Harper (Australia) |
Player of the Match | Mashrafe Mortaza |
